Synthetic intelligence can dramatically enhance the probabilities of choosing up the early-warning indicators of oesophageal most cancers, a pioneering NHS programme has proven.

The pc expertise works by analysing footage taken throughout a process generally known as an endoscopy, when a tiny digital camera on the top of a versatile tube is put down the throat – performing as ‘an additional pair of eyes’ to assist docs to establish pre-cancerous cells within the gullet.

At current, one in 5 circumstances are missed by docs throughout an everyday endoscopy – with typically extreme penalties. However new trial outcomes of the factitious intelligence software program present it could actually precisely spot indicators of pre-cancer throughout endoscopies in 92 per cent of sufferers.

About 9,000 Britons are identified with oesophageal most cancers every year. Sufferers with the most typical kind – adenocarcinoma – dwell for a mean of only a yr after prognosis, making it probably the most lethal types of the illness.

Widespread signs embody a lack of urge for food, problem swallowing and acid reflux disease. In as much as 13 per cent of sufferers, the illness is preceded by a situation referred to as Barrett’s oesophagus – when cells lining the oesophagus change and mutate. Acid reflux disease is regarded as the primary trigger – because the abdomen acid rising up into the oesophagus damages these cells. One in ten sufferers with acid reflux disease develop Barrett’s.

In roughly one in 100 circumstances every year, the cell adjustments can turn out to be pre-cancerous – a situation referred to as dysplasia – and later flip into full blown most cancers.

Pre-cancerous cells might be surgically eliminated throughout the identical endoscopy process, utilizing a high-quality wire handed down the throat to scrape away mutated cells. Research present the process is very efficient with 95 per cent of sufferers nonetheless most cancers free after ten years.

Within the case of full-blown oesophageal most cancers, remedy includes eradicating a portion of the gullet. Throughout the operation, incisions are made into the neck, abdomen or stomach of the affected person to take away half or the entire gullet and change it with a bit of the abdomen or bowel. However for greater than half of those sufferers, the most cancers returns inside two to a few years.

Superior illness is handled with a mix of chemotherapy and radiotherapy. This can be adopted by immunotherapy if different therapies cease working.

Nevertheless, at this level the most cancers is normally incurable – and simply 15 per cent of sufferers survive for 5 years or extra.

The synthetic intelligence software program, referred to as CADU, will increase the chance of detecting oesophageal most cancers early by highlighting areas of concern within the affected person’s throat invisible to the bare eye. Because the physician feeds a digital camera down the affected person’s throat, the software program analyses footage the physician is seeing in actual time and produces warnings that flash up on-screen, directing the surgeon to probably irregular cells.

The expertise is permitted by UK well being regulators and has been in use at London’s UCH for the previous yr. Specialists imagine it is going to be reviewed for wider use in NHS hospitals inside the subsequent yr.

Professor Haidry says: ‘One man in his 60s got here in not too long ago struggling with signs of Barrett’s oesophagus. Trying on the display screen throughout the endoscopy, I couldn’t see any indicators of pre-cancer. However the AI system picked it up immediately and highlighted the realm.

‘After scraping away the cells and sending them off to the lab, the outcomes got here again inside every week – and the pc had been proper. The cells had been precancerous.’

The affected person is now, hopefully, not prone to most cancers growing, and Prof Haidry says: ‘Examine this to remedy for precise oesophageal most cancers – sufferers have a large operation to take away a part of the oesophagus.

‘This includes spending weeks in hospital, and it could actually take as much as six months to get well.

‘With the AI process, the chance concerned is minimal and sufferers can go residence the next day.’
